#d17958 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d17958 is composed of 82% red, 47.5%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 42.1% magenta, 57.9%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 16.4 degrees, a saturation of 56.8% and a lightness of 58.2%. #d17958 color hex could be obtained by blending #fff2b0 with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#d17958 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d17958 has RGB values of R:209, G:121,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.42, Y:0.58,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13728088.

Shades and Tints of #d17958
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020101 is the darkest color, while #fbf4f2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d17958
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#989391 is the less saturated color, while #fa662f is the most saturated one.
